I have a pyrantha planted on a bank in a very open situation for a few years. Unfortunately it seems to have lost its leaves and is not thriving,any idea what the problem could be.

This is probably pyracantha scab disease, which is like apple scab disease, and it svery common.

You can either remove the bush or spray it three or four times in spring and early summer with a rose blackspot spray.
